Output 84e701f52865f03fcb7e316bc77eb30957a58bf7cab83f2ea18a37bfe5066263:1

value
643440
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 075256758707d55325e0bb91d77971c1c8b5c0bf OP_EQUALVERIFY OP_CHECKSIG
address
1fiNGaiw1hRN4p6mziq9QkqcUwU2VbBnr
transaction
84e701f52865f03fcb7e316bc77eb30957a58bf7cab83f2ea18a37bfe5066263
confirmations
306598
spent
true